BDUK revises CityFibre Project Gigabit contract for Kent

UK Government · May 26, 2026 · ✓ verified

BDUK has announced a redesign of the Kent Project Gigabit contract with CityFibre in May 2026.

  • Main announcement: In May 2026 CityFibre and Building Digital UK (BDUK) agreed to redesign the Kent contract, reducing the scope to cover around 9,000 premises and backed by £26.1 million investment through Project Gigabit. The redesign was made to minimise overlap with other suppliers’ commercial rollout and focus public funding on premises that would otherwise miss out.
  • Background and details: The original contract, signed January 2024, was a £112 million award to Cityfibre to provide around 50,000 hard-to-reach premises in Kent; first premises were anticipated in 2024. The government is also providing up to £210 million in voucher funding under the Gigabit Broadband Voucher Scheme and is engaging with other suppliers to reach remaining premises.
